CommandSource Výčet
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Výčty používané podtřídami CommandEventDataa k označení zdroje použitého DbCommand ke spuštění příkazu.
public enum CommandSource
type CommandSource =
Public Enum CommandSource
- Dědičnost
-
CommandSource
Pole
BulkUpdate | 8 | Příkaz se vygeneroval jako součást hromadné aktualizace. |
ExecuteDelete | 9 | Příkaz byl vygenerován jako součást operace ExecuteDelete. |
ExecuteSqlRaw | 5 | Příkaz byl vygenerován voláním ExecuteSqlRaw(DatabaseFacade, String, Object[]), ExecuteSqlRawAsync(DatabaseFacade, String, CancellationToken), ExecuteSql(DatabaseFacade, FormattableString), ExecuteSqlAsync(DatabaseFacade, FormattableString, CancellationToken), ExecuteSqlInterpolated(DatabaseFacade, FormattableString)nebo ExecuteSqlInterpolatedAsync(DatabaseFacade, FormattableString, CancellationToken). |
ExecuteUpdate | 8 | Příkaz se vygeneroval jako součást operace ExecuteUpdate. |
FromSqlQuery | 4 | Příkaz byl vygenerován voláním FromSql<TEntity>(DbSet<TEntity>, FormattableString), FromSqlRaw<TEntity>(DbSet<TEntity>, String, Object[]) nebo FromSqlInterpolated<TEntity>(DbSet<TEntity>, FormattableString) |
LinqQuery | 1 | Příkaz se vygeneroval z dotazu LINQ na objektu DbSet<TEntity>. |
Migrations | 3 | Příkaz byl vygenerován migrací EF Core. |
SaveChanges | 2 | Příkaz se vygeneroval z volání nebo SaveChanges()SaveChangesAsync(CancellationToken) |
Scaffolding | 7 | Příkaz se vygeneroval jako součást generování uživatelského rozhraní (zpětné analýzy) z existující databáze. |
Unknown | 0 | Příkaz byl vygenerován z neznámého zdroje. To obvykle označuje příkaz vygenerovaný poskytovatelem databáze. |
ValueGenerator | 6 | Příkaz byl vygenerován příkazem ValueGenerator. |
Poznámky
Další informace a příklady najdete v tématu Protokolování, události a diagnostika .
Platí pro
Entity Framework